What the Filing Says About NATIONAL FISH & WILDLIFE TAX DEFERRED RETIREMENT PLAN

NATIONAL FISH & WILDLIFE TAX DEFERRED RETIREMENT PLAN is a 401(k) retirement plan sponsored by NATIONAL FISH & WILDLIFE FOUNDATION, headquartered in District of Columbia. As of the 2022 Form 5500 filing, the plan reports $39M in total end-of-year assets and covers 129 participants across the Professional & Technical Services industry. The sponsor's EIN on file with the U.S. Department of Labor is 521384139, and the plan has been effective since 1989-01-01. Its filing status is currently FILING RECEIVED.

Year over year, total assets moved from $47M at the beginning of 2022 to $39M at year-end — a decline of 17.0%. Net assets (after liabilities) closed the year at $39M, with reported net income of $-8,085,269 driven by investment returns, contributions received, and benefit payments during the period. These figures reflect what the plan administrator certified on Schedule H or Schedule I of the Form 5500 annual return and can be compared against 2 prior plan-year filings from the same sponsor shown below.

Asset totals and participant counts reflect a single plan year snapshot and can change materially with market conditions, plan mergers, or workforce changes. Fields such as "net income" include both realized investment performance and contribution/distribution flows — a single-year figure does not by itself indicate plan health or participant outcomes.
